Linux/Kubernetes Automation Engineer

PeratonLinthicum Heights, MD
4d$104,000 - $166,000Onsite

About The Position

As the world's leading mission capability integrator and transformative enterprise IT provider, we deliver trusted and highly differentiated national security solutions and technologies that keep people safe and secure. Peraton serves as a valued partner to essential government agencies across the intelligence, space, cyber, defense, civilian, health, and state and local markets. Peraton is seeking a Linux/Kubernetes Automation Engineer to join our team of qualified, diverse individuals. The Linux/Kubernetes Automation Engineer is needed to help maintain on premises and cloud Kubernetes environments. This position would help in the administration and configuration of Kubernetes environments to facilitate application hosting. Deploying applications in an automated containerized fashion on Kubernetes, help in the scalability, reliability, and maintenance while reducing cost and improving performance. Integration with Continuous Integration/Continuous Delivery (CI/CD) pipelines will also increase productivity and faster time to deployment. This position would be responsible for the maintenance and integration of the multiple on premises and cloud hosted environments.

Requirements

  • 5 years with a Bachelor's degree; 3 years with Master's degree; 0 years with PhD. Degree must be in one of the following disciplines: Information Systems, Information Technology, Software Engineering, Computer Science, Data Science, or Cybersecurity.
  • In lieu of a Bachelor's degree, candidate must possess an additional 4 years of relevant experience and one of the following active certifications: Cloud+, GICSP, GSEC, Security+, SSCP, SecurityX/CASP+, CCNP Security, CCSP, FITSP-O, or GFACT.
  • Active IAT Level II certification is required.
  • Minimum Clearance Requirement: Active Secret.
  • Expertise managing Red Hat (RHEL) systems with Ansible Playbooks.
  • Experience with version control systems (e.g., Git) and their integration into CI tools (e.g., Gitlab CI).
  • Understanding of cloud platforms (AWS, Azure) (Primarily Azure).
  • Knowledge of Kubernetes systems and deployments.
  • Proficiency in containerization technologies.
  • Expertise deploying and managing Kubernetes clusters.
  • Knowledge of cybersecurity principles.
  • Knowledge of computer networking concepts and protocols.
  • Knowledge of cyber threats and vulnerabilities.

Nice To Haves

  • Experience automating execution of Ansible playbooks through tools such as AWX, Ansible Tower, Run Deck, or GitLab.
  • Experience deploying and managing observability and monitoring platforms such as Grafana, SolarWinds, or similar.
  • Experience deploying and managing SIEMs such as Splunk.
  • Basic ability to program in languages such as Java, Python, or C#.
  • Knowledge of continuous integration and continuous delivery (CI/CD) tools (GitLab CI).
  • Experience with Infrastructure as Code (IaC) technologies such as Terraform.

Responsibilities

  • Design and build components encompassing network, security, identity, governance, development and operations in Azure cloud environments.
  • Operationalize solutions from proof-of-concept through production using automation for repeatability, maintainability, and to enforce standards
  • Proven “automation-first” mindset with a focus on efficiency and scalability.
  • Schedule: Core hours are 0930-1430 Monday-Friday to ensure overlap with the team, attendance is expected outside of this window as needed to support meetings, deployments, and team activities.
  • The system administration team is expected to have on-site coverage 0600-1800 Monday-Friday and schedules will be coordinated with other members of the team to ensure this coverage.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service